The history of Florida can be traced to when the first Paleo-Indians began to inhabit the peninsula as early as 14,000 years ago. [1] They left behind artifacts and archeological remains. Romans was born Barend Romans in Delft, son of Pieter Barendsz Romans and Margareta van der Linden. [2] [3] He was raised and educated there, but emigrated to Great Britain as a youth or young man, and then to British North America around 1757, during the Seven Years' War, known as the French and Indian War in British North America.

Maps of the New World had been produced since the 16th century. The history of cartography of the United States begins in the 18th century, after the declared independence of the original Thirteen Colonies on July 4, 1776, during the American Revolutionary War (1776–1783).
